This A2B2E2K2Hg P3 combined filter with RD40x1/7 (DIN/EN 148-1) thread is designed for high-risk industrial environments where multiple airborne hazards may be present at once. It provides broad-spectrum protection against organic vapours (A), inorganic gases (B), acid gases (E), ammonia and amines (K), mercury vapours (Hg), and high-efficiency particulate filtration (P3) for dusts, fumes, fibres and aerosols.

Engineered to recognised international requirements for gas and particle filtration, the filter meets A2B2E2K2HgP3 classification to EN 14387 and is suitable for use where compatible with powered air and respirator systems assessed to EN 12941/EN 12942 levels. It also includes tested protection against ozone at concentrations below 20 mg/m3, supporting additional risk control for specific industrial processes.
With a long unopened shelf life (10 years) and defined operating conditions (-10°C to +55°C), this filter supports cost-efficient procurement and workforce readiness across project cycles. Always conduct site-specific risk assessment and ensure correct respirator compatibility, fit, and change-out schedules based on exposure levels and environmental conditions.
